At 541 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m over Montgomery, moving southeast at 5 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 50 mph and penny size hail.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Minor damage to outdoor objects is possible. Locations impacted include... Coffee Bluff, Midtown Savannah, Windsor Forest, Hunter Army Airfield, Wilmington Island, Montgomery, Vernonburg, Skidaway Island, Isle Of Hope and Sandfly.
